Why Are cookies a security risk?
Yet, depending on how cookies are used and exposed, they can represent a serious security risk. For instance, cookies can be hijacked. As most websites utilize cookies as the only identifiers for user sessions, if a cookie is hijacked, an attacker could be able to impersonate a user and gain unauthorized access.

Are cookies on your phone bad?
The standalone data of a cookie is not inherently bad, nor a type of malware. It’s the concern of what a website will do with that data that can be harmful to a user’s privacy. Virtual criminals could potentially use the information from cookies to data-mine browsing history.

Will clearing cache delete pictures?
The device should only clear the thumbnail cache which is used to show the images faster in the gallery when you scroll. It is also used in other places such as file manager. The cache will be rebuild again unless you reduce the number of images on your device. So, deleting it adds very less practical benefit.

Will clearing cache delete history?
Clearing out a web browser’s cache does not damage any information stored in a browser, such as bookmarks or your homepage. Instead, it simply makes the web browser think that you have not visited a webpage before. … Think of it as a little spring-cleaning for your favorite browser on your desktop or mobile device.

Do cell phones store cookies?
Cookies do exist on the mobile web just as they do on the desktop. Users who browse the Internet using mobile web browsers get cookies placed on their browsers. Every mobile browser, just like desktop browsers, has different cookie settings and handle first party and third party cookies differently.

How do I clear cookies for a particular site?
Delete specific cookies
- On your computer, open Chrome.
- At the top right, click More. Settings.
- Under “Privacy and security,” click Cookies and other site data.
- Click See all cookies and site data.
- At the top right, search for the website’s name.
- To the right of the site, click Remove .
